Infants & Toddlers, Under Three Years old

  • Under IDEA, “infants and toddlers with disabilities“ are defined as individuals under three years of age who need early intervention services because they— are experiencing developmental delays, as measured by appropriate diagnostic instruments and procedures, in one or more of the following areas: 
    • cognitive development
    • physical development 
    • communication development
    • social or emotional development 
    • adaptive development or have a diagnosed physical or mental condition that has a high probability of resulting in developmental delay.

Children & Youth Aged 3-21 Years old

  • IDEA lists 13 different disability categories under which 3- through 21-year-olds may be eligible for services. The disability categories listed in IDEA are:
    • autism
    • deafness
    • emotional disturbance
    • hearing impairment
    • intellectual disability
    • multiple disabilities
    • orthopedic impairment
    • other health impairment
    • specific learning disability
    • speech or language impairment
    • traumatic brain injury
    • visual impairment
